Parton station may be small, but it's equipped with some essential amenities to facilitate your travel. Although the station lacks a ticket office, rest assured that there are ticket machines on-site for purchasing or collecting pre-bought tickets, and these machines are accessible, featuring induction loops for those with hearing impairments. While Smartcards can be issued here, it’s important to note there are no smartcard validators available.
Accessibility could be a challenge; the station is classified as a Category C, which means there is no step-free access available. Platform access involves navigating several steps, and unfortunately, there are no ramps. Thus, if you require assistance, it might be best to plan with that in mind. There are no waiting rooms, nor is there available seating apart from a few benches.
When it comes to onward travel, Parton offers a handful of connections to ensure your journey doesn't end on the platform. Rail replacement services are close by with bus stops positioned conveniently on the A595. Travelers can also check out the local bus services for a wider reach in the area, or use the Cab4you service for ordering taxis. For more localized travel and help planning bus routes, the busline at 0871 200 2233 could be a great tool.

Menston Station is equipped with various facilities to ensure a seamless travel experience. The ticket office is open from 06:15 to 17:30 on weekdays, and 09:15 to 16:30 on Sundays, offering flexibility for early risers and weekend travelers. Ticket machines provide an alternative way to pick up your tickets, and they're accessible to persons with reduced mobility as well. For those leveraging technology, smartcards can be issued and validated at the station, which caters to the modern commuter.
Accessibility at the station is moderately facilitated. The station is a Category B site, which allows level access to platform 1, while access to the Leeds/Bradford platform requires crossing a footbridge, slightly lessening convenience for mobility-impaired passengers. It is recommended they travel via Ilkley to change platforms. Rest assured, Menston Station strives to ensure a safe environment with CCTV cameras in operation, and assistance booking through Passenger Assist is just two hours away offering peace of mind whenever you travel.
Beyond the station, Menston offers a network of onward travel options to suit every commuter's needs. Engage the Rail Replacement Service conveniently at the station's car park if rail disruptions occur. For taxi hire, discover helpful resources and plan your ride with the support of online services here. Bus lines are also readily accessible, with local services reachable through Busline at 0871 200 2233. Lastly, for those setting off on an international adventure, the nearby Leeds/Bradford Airport at Yeadon makes flying a breeze.
